How to Make a Pull-Out Sofa Bed More Comfortable
Pull-out sofa beds, also known as sleeper sofas, offer a practical solution for accommodating overnight guests or maximizing space in a small apartment. However, their reputation for discomfort is well-earned. Many pull-out sofas are notorious for their thin mattresses, uneven surfaces, and uncomfortable frames. Fortunately, several strategies can be employed to transform a sleep-depriving sleeper sofa into a comfortable sleeping haven.
Upgrade the Mattress
The mattress is the foundation of a comfortable sleep experience, and this holds especially true for pull-out sofa beds. The standard mattress that comes with most sleeper sofas is often thin, flimsy, and lacking proper support. Upgrading the mattress is the most significant step towards improving comfort. Consider these options:
- Memory Foam Mattress Topper: A memory foam topper provides a plush, conforming surface that molds to the contours of your body, relieving pressure points and promoting better spinal alignment. Look for toppers with a thickness of at least 2 inches for optimal comfort.
- Gel-Infused Memory Foam Mattress: These toppers incorporate gel particles that enhance airflow and dissipate heat, preventing the mattress from feeling overly warm and uncomfortable. They provide a balance of support and pressure relief.
- Latex Mattress Topper: Latex toppers are known for their responsiveness and breathability. They provide a bouncy feel and excellent support, making them suitable for people who prefer a firmer sleep surface.
- Replace the Entire Mattress: If you're willing to invest, consider replacing the entire mattress with a dedicated foam or innerspring mattress designed for sleeper sofas. These mattresses are often thicker and more durable than the standard mattress included with the sofa.
Enhance Support and Comfort
While a new mattress significantly improves comfort, additional adjustments can further elevate the sleeping experience. Consider these enhancements for a more supportive and comfortable sleep surface:
- Add a Mattress Pad: A mattress pad provides an extra layer of cushioning and protection for your mattress. Choose a pad made from soft materials like cotton or down for added comfort.
- Invest in Pillows: Comfortable pillows are essential for proper head and neck support. Choose pillows with a firmness level that suits your sleeping style. Consider using a combination of pillows, such as a firm pillow for support and a softer pillow for comfort.
- Use a Blanket or Quilt: A warm and cozy blanket can significantly improve the overall comfort of your sleep surface. Opt for a plush and breathable blanket made from soft materials like fleece, microfiber, or down.
Addressing Structural Issues
The frame and mechanism of a pull-out sofa bed can also contribute to discomfort. If you're experiencing issues with uneven surfaces or creaking noises, consider these solutions:
- Reinforce the Frame: If the frame is unstable or creaky, consider reinforcing it with additional supports like wooden slats or metal bracing. This can help distribute weight more evenly and prevent sagging.
- Lubricate the Mechanism: The hinges, latches, and other moving parts of the sofa bed mechanism can become stiff over time. Applying lubricant, such as silicone spray or WD-40, can help to reduce friction and smooth out operation.
- Adjust the Legs: If the sofa is uneven or wobbly, adjusting the legs can help level it out. Use shims or small blocks to raise or lower the legs as needed.
